Cost of Living in Jaipur

Jaipur is a ultra-budget destination for digital nomads. A comfortable monthly budget including city centre rent, mid-range dining, and public transport comes to approximately $618 — that's 48% below the global average of $1,180.

Rent is the biggest expense: a 1-bedroom apartment in the city centre averages $437/month, while moving outside the centre drops that to $247. Eating out is remarkably cheap — a cheap meal costs $3 and a cappuccino runs $1. Budget-conscious nomads who cook at home and live outside the centre can manage on as little as $459/month.

Internet and Connectivity

Average internet speed in Jaipur is 30 Mbps download and 14 Mbps upload, which is adequate for most remote work. Reliability scores 4.2/10. This handles most remote work tasks including video calls, though simultaneous large uploads may cause slowdowns.

The city has 69 coworking spaces with average speeds of 25 Mbps — roughly matching residential connections. Day passes start at $10 and monthly memberships average $86.

Safety and Healthcare

Jaipur scores 50/100 for safety (Good), which is below the global average. Exercise standard precautions: avoid poorly-lit areas at night, keep valuables secure, and research neighbourhoods before booking long-term accommodation.

Healthcare quality scores 53/100. Adequate healthcare for routine needs. Consider comprehensive travel insurance that covers emergency evacuation for peace of mind. Air quality scores 24/100 and walkability 41/100.

What language do they speak in Jaipur?
The primary language in Jaipur is Hindi. While Hindi is the local language, most coworking spaces, cafes popular with remote workers, and tourist areas have English-speaking staff. Learning basic Hindi phrases will greatly enhance your experience.
Do I need a visa to work remotely from Jaipur?
India does not currently have a specific digital nomad visa programme. Check entry requirements based on your nationality — many countries allow tourist stays of 30-90 days, during which remote work for a foreign employer is often tolerated.
